Gender equality roadmap and sexual harassment consultation
Consultations
The roadmap confirms that a consultation will be undertaken on a new employment right to carers’ leave. A consultation on the effectiveness of workplace sexual harassment legislation has now started and runs until 2 October 2019 (see Follow up ).

This consultation covers whether to: (1) introduce a new legal duty on employers to prevent sexual harassment in the workplace; (2) strengthen protection against third-party harassment; (3) extend protection to interns and volunteers; and (4) extend the three-month tribunal time limit for bringing discrimination and harassment claims.
A consultation on increasing the transparency of employers’ parental leave and pay policies has also now started as part of a wider consultation - we’ll discuss this in a separate article.
Other matters
The roadmap also says that: (1) technical guidance on sexual harassment at work will be published later in 2019 and will form the basis of a statutory Code of Practice; and (2) the enforcement of equal pay legislation and the gender pay gap metrics will both be reviewed to assess their effectiveness.
